Code § 29-3-7","heading":"Oath of Successors.","body":"Promptly after designation, each emergency interim successor shall take the oath required for the legislator to whose powers and duties he is designated to succeed. No other oath shall be required. The oath shall be administered by any person authorized by law to administer the oath to duly elected legislators.","path":["Title 29 Legislature.","Chapter 3 Emergency Interim Succession."],"source_url":"https://alison.legislature.state.al.us/code-of-alabama?section=29-3-7","current_through":"Act 2026-611","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-03T14:01:51Z","sha256":"cdf97ee65926a14b61681a51bd15bdbb359d750a27f032aee6f02432f7072f99","source_id":"us-al","stale":false,"prev":"us-al/ala.-code-29-3-6","next":"us-al/ala.-code-29-3-8"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
